Chicago: The Strategic Nexus of American Logistics

Chicago remains the "Logistics Capital of America," a status fueled by its unique position as the only city where all six major North American Class I railroads meet. For warehouse rack manufacturers and factories, the Chicago market represents more than just a destination; it is a complex ecosystem requiring high-performance storage solutions that can handle the sheer velocity of the I-80 and I-90 corridors.

From the massive distribution hubs in the Inland Port of Joliet to the high-throughput fulfillment centers near O'Hare International Airport, the demand for "Information Gain" in storage design is critical. Industrial operators in Chicago are no longer looking for simple steel frames; they require intelligent racking systems that integrate with AS/RS (Automated Storage and Retrieval Systems), IoT sensors for load monitoring, and seismic-compliant structures that adhere to RMI (Rack Manufacturers Institute) standards.

Frequently Asked Questions for Chicago Industrial Buyers

Q: What are the primary lead times for shipping warehouse racks to Chicago?

A: Typically, manufacturing takes 15-25 days depending on the volume. Ocean freight to Chicago (via West Coast rail bridge or All-Water) takes approximately 30-40 days. We offer expedited logistics for urgent project kick-offs.

Q: Do your racking systems comply with Illinois Building Codes and RMI standards?

A: Yes. All our heavy-duty systems are designed to meet or exceed RMI (Rack Manufacturers Institute) MH16.1 specifications, ensuring easy permitting and insurance compliance in the City of Chicago and surrounding suburbs.
